Point T has coordinates (10,20). To calculate the coordinates of point T′ in the image,
Hatshy [7]

Answer: T'(18,36)

Step-by-step explanation:

For this exercise it is important to know the definition of "Dilation".

 A Dilation is defined as a transformation in which the Image (The figure obtained after the transformation) and the Pre-Image (The original figure before the transformation) have the same shape but have different sizes.

If the Dilation is centered at the origin, and knowing the scale factor of \frac{9}{5}, you need to multiply each coordinate of the point T by the scale factor in order to find the coordinates of the Image T'.

Knowing that the point T has the following coordinates:

T(10,20)

You get that the coordinates of the Image T' are the shown below:

T'=(\frac{9}{5}*10,\frac{9}{5}*20)\\\\T'=(18,36)
